Thanks for all of your previous help. I am now trying to choose bulbs for my 150gallon tank. 60x24x24. I am planning 3 250w halides via retrofit kits since I am making a canopy. Question is what bulb to go with? I do not plan on adding supplemental actinic lighting. I like the look of several of the 14k range bulbs but am concerned about lower PAR ratings. What is the best compromise bulb with decent PAR and also has a nice blue-white color? I plan to run it off Icecap electronic ballasts.

Marine depot has retro kits with the 12k ALS bulb as well as the 14k Hamiltons. These seem to be priced ok. What do you think??

FWIW, I tried the 250W Hamilton bulbs, DE HQI, and I found them too yellowish. I switched to XM 20K, 250W DE, and I don't regret it. There is a slight blueish tint similar to what there is under water. Really cool effect. Try to find a LFS or fellow reefer that has them, to see for yourself. It's really a matter of personal taste. :)
